Understanding Bifidobacterium breve
Bifidobacterium breve is a beneficial probiotic bacterium naturally found in the human gastrointestinal tract. It is particularly prominent in the guts of breastfed infants, where it plays a key role in breaking down human milk oligosaccharides (HMOs) that the infant's own body cannot digest. While a natural and dominant early colonizer of the gut, its presence and composition shift throughout a person's lifespan, changing in response to diet and other environmental factors. Beyond its foundational role in infancy, specific strains of B. breve have been clinically studied for a wide range of applications, from managing digestive disorders to supporting cognitive health.
The Importance of Strain Specificity
One of the most important takeaways when considering B. breve is that its benefits are highly strain-specific. Just as different breeds of dogs have different capabilities, different strains of B. breve (e.g., M-16V, B-3, BR03, A1) are associated with different health outcomes. This is why it is crucial to look for products that clearly list the specific strain used, along with the corresponding clinical evidence. For instance, a strain that benefits infant colic may not be the same one studied for adult weight management.
Key Health Applications for B. breve
Digestive Health and Comfort
B. breve plays a significant role in promoting a healthy digestive system for both infants and adults. It produces short-chain fatty acids (SCFAs) like lactic and acetic acid, which help lower the colon's pH, creating an unfavorable environment for harmful pathogens. Specific strains have been shown to help with a variety of digestive issues:
- Infant Colic and Constipation: Strains like M-16V have been studied for their ability to improve gastrointestinal motility and reduce symptoms of infant colic and constipation.
- Irritable Bowel Syndrome (IBS): Certain combinations including B. breve have been linked to an improvement in symptoms like bloating, abdominal pain, and overall satisfaction with digestion in IBS patients.
- Inflammatory Bowel Disease (IBD): As a component of multi-strain probiotic formulations like VSL#3, B. breve has been used as a nutritional treatment for conditions such as ulcerative colitis.
Immune System Modulation
As a core component of the gut microbiome, B. breve interacts directly with the body's immune system, which has a significant portion of its tissue located in the gut. This interaction helps train and modulate immune responses, supporting overall resilience.
- Infant Immunity: In preterm infants, supplementation with B. breve can help prevent infections and reduce the risk of life-threatening conditions like necrotizing enterocolitis (NEC) by promoting healthy gut colonization.
- Allergy Management: Some strains have been shown to modulate immune responses associated with allergic conditions like atopic dermatitis (eczema) and allergic rhinitis. This occurs by helping to balance immune cell ratios and reduce inflammation.
Emerging Cognitive and Metabolic Benefits
Research into the gut-brain axis has revealed that B. breve may have a wider reach than just the digestive system. Emerging studies indicate potential benefits for both cognitive function and metabolism.
- Cognitive Support: Preclinical and early human studies with specific strains, such as B. breve A1 or MCC1274, have suggested potential improvements in cognitive measures for conditions like Alzheimer's disease and age-related decline.
- Metabolic Health and Weight Management: The B-3 strain of B. breve has been studied for its anti-obesity effects, showing potential to reduce body fat and improve certain metabolic markers in pre-obese individuals.
The Gut-Skin Connection
The gut and skin communicate via the gut-skin axis. A healthy gut microbiome can influence the skin's health and appearance, and some B. breve strains have been shown to be beneficial in this area. Studies on strains like B. breve BR3 have demonstrated improvements in atopic dermatitis (eczema) symptoms.
Comparison: B. breve's Role in Infants vs. Adults
| Feature | Role in Infants | Role in Adults |
|---|---|---|
| Dominance | A dominant early colonizer, especially in breastfed infants, critical for establishing a healthy microbiome. | A less dominant but still important member of a more diverse and mature gut microbiome. |
| Key Function | Ferments human milk oligosaccharides (HMOs) that the infant cannot digest, promoting gut development and nutrient production. | Ferments a broader range of dietary fibers and resistant starches, contributing to overall digestive health. |
| Main Application | Prevention and treatment of pediatric issues like colic, constipation, and NEC in preterm infants. | Management of inflammatory and functional gastrointestinal disorders (e.g., IBS, IBD), plus cognitive and metabolic support. |
| Immune Impact | Early immune system training and maturation. Helps protect against infections. | Modulates immune responses to help manage inflammation and allergic reactions. |
Potential Risks and Considerations
While B. breve is generally considered safe for most healthy individuals, certain groups should exercise caution. Probiotics can pose a risk for severely immunocompromised individuals or patients in intensive care. Additionally, starting a new probiotic may cause mild digestive changes like gas or bloating, which typically subside with consistent use. It is always recommended to consult a healthcare provider before beginning any new supplement, especially for those with existing health conditions.
